Meltbox
Inbox for briefs from your agents. Better human in the loop.
Meltbox is an inbox for context-rich interactive briefs from your agents. Right now when an agent needs you, you end up having to look through terminal scrollback, localhost tabs, and Slack DMs to yourself. In Meltbox, your agents push small interactive pages with all the context you need to make a decision. You triage briefs in a keyboard-fast inbox, tap an answer, and your reply flows straight back to the agent.
I'm Will, a solo founder, and I built Meltbox.
I run a lot of different agents across a lot of different machines. My workflow changed drastically as agents improved. I started having them build full internal apps and throwaway dashboards just to let me make critical decisions better (i.e. a review system for locking in a creative matrix, an app to explore competitor positioning, etc..). I needed this to just become the default for how I work and not only for coding, but for everything my agents do for me.
Meltbox is the inbox for that. Your agents push briefs, small interactive pages that lay out all the context you need to make a decision. You triage them like email, keyboard first, click an answer, and your reply flows straight back to the agent as their next step.

Meltbox was hunted by William Wnekowicz. A “hunter” on Product Hunt is the community member who submits a product to the platform — uploading the images, the link, and tagging the makers behind it. Hunters typically write the first comment explaining why a product is worth attention, and their followers are notified the moment they post. Around 79% of featured launches on Product Hunt are self-hunted by their makers, but a well-known hunter still acts as a signal of quality to the rest of the community.
